Wow, I really should try SketchUp again some time. Tried it once, but found it a bit limited, especially when it comes to organic / curved modeling.

A few questions, if you don't mind:

Is the SketchUp interface tablet-friendly (not very keyboard-dependent, like Blender) ?

Does SketchUp natively support animation?

Sketchup has the more friendly Interface user that you can find!
(we can say Moi is the SketchUp of the nurbs! so...
If you use a tablet you must have something for replace the Middle mouse whell of the Zoom in/out !
All plugins shown follow are free! (There are maybe 2 000 to 3 000 plugins! ;)

About curves you must use a special Plugins "Bezier Z" by Fredo6 for create curves like Moi Curves (even of course it's not nurbs! ;)
here only one icon function (see the tool barr ;)


About animation : natively there is automatic animation of camera beteween scenes ! And animation of Plane section!
So very efficient!



About traditionnal animation like Blender TimeLine etc... now you can with Animator by Fredo 6 again! ;)


You have also "Physic animation" with MS Physics


About organic inside : you have 2 Plugins (not free) Artisan & SUbDiv
http://artisan4sketchup.com/ by Dale Martens
http://evilsoftwareempire.com/subd by Thomthom

A free one but very very basic
Subdivision Loop http://www.guitar-list.com/download-software/sketchup-loop-subdivision-smooth-plugin

You have a free one (Not subdive) Organic by Patch technic by Thomthom


You have also organic like "ZBrush Sculpture" but it's not the first objective of SketchUp who is a Box Modeler! :)
Sculpt Tool by BTM http://forums.sketchucation.com/viewtopic.php?f=180&t=20781&st=0&sk=t&sd=a&hilit=sculpt#p174501


I believe that you have better way for simple organic : make it inside MOI
For complex organic use free ones like Rocket 3F, Wings3D, MeshMixer ...exotic like TopMod, Neobarok...
or the very powerful for real organic Sculpture Sculptris : http://pixologic.com/sculptris/ then export Import inside SketchUP!
by OBJ formats!
